Analysis
MDG: Eastern Asia recorded 1.06 GPIA for inbound mobility rate, adjusted gender parity index (uis estimate) in 2023. That is the highest value across all 19 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.2% on the previous year and up 7.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, inbound mobility rate, adjusted gender parity index (uis estimate) in MDG: Eastern Asia peaked at 1.06 GPIA in 2023 and was at its lowest, 0.9328 GPIA, in 2005.
MDG: Eastern Asia ranks 31st of 200 groups on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 19 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.953 GPIA | 0.9328 GPIA | 0.9707 GPIA | 5 |
| 2010s | 0.9818 GPIA | 0.9757 GPIA | 1.01 GPIA |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.02 GPIA | 0.9895 GPIA | 1.06 GPIA | 4 |
